Mobile Payments Library
Initialize The Library
Mobile Payments Library
new Thread() {public void run() { instance = PayPal.getInstance(); if (instance == null) { instance = PayPal.initWithAppID( context, ID, // YOUR APP'S ID PayPal.ENV_SANDBOX ); }}
}.start();

Mobile Payments Library
Simple Payment: PayPalPayment payment = new PayPalPayment();payment.setRecipient("[email protected]");payment.setCurrencyType("USD");payment.setPaymentType(PayPal.PAYMENT_TYPE_GOODS);payment.setSubtotal(new BigDecimal(”29.99"));PayPalInvoiceItem item = new PayPalInvoiceItem();item.setName("Hipster T-Shirt");item.setQuantity(1);item.setTotalPrice(new BigDecimal(”29.99"));PayPalInvoiceData data = new PayPalInvoiceData();data.add(item);payment.setInvoiceData(data);
Mobile Payments Library
Parallel Payment: PayPalAdvancedPayment payment = new PayPalAdvancedPayment();payment.setCurrencyType("USD");PayPalReceiverDetails firstReceiver =
new PayPalReceiverDetails();firstReceiver.setRecipient("[email protected]");firstReceiver.setSubtotal(new BigDecimal("10.00"));PayPalReceiverDetails secondReceiver =
new PayPalReceiverDetails();secondReceiver.setRecipient("[email protected]");secondReceiver.setSubtotal(new BigDecimal("20.00"));payment.getReceivers().add(firstReceiver);payment.getReceivers().add(secondReceiver);
Mobile Payments Library
Execute The Payment
Mobile Payments Library
Intent payIntent =instance.checkout(invoice, context);
startActivityForResult(payIntent, REQUEST);
GET THE INTENT:
Can be used with a Delegate instead Intent payIntent =instance.checkout( invoice, context, delegate);
startActivity(payIntent);
Mobile Payments Library
Receive the result: protected void onActivityResult(
int requestCode, int resultCode, Intent data) { if (requestCode == REQUEST) { switch (resultCode) { case Activity.RESULT_OK: showText("Success"); break; case Activity.RESULT_CANCELED: showText("Canceled"); break; case PayPalActivity.RESULT_FAILURE: showText("Failure"); break; } }}
